What is meant by Subdividing Land?
When one block of land is subdivided into two or more blocks, then the process is subdivision. Residential or freehold subdivision is the common subdivision type that involves splitting one land lot into multiple lots. Either the land could be  Torrens or a community titled block – depending on the land owner and land management.  

On the other hand, you could own a house or have purchased a vacant plot – then you would have your eyes on a Torrens title. This title is much more common when shared or common areas like driveways and other facilities are lacking. Strata and community titles enter the process in subdivision project management when the shared common areas are present. Usually, these are seen with the units and townhouses.

Generally, five types of subdivisions are permitted in Australian states –

i. Freehold / Residential Subdivision
One existing block divided into two or more separate titles is Freehold/residential subdivision.

ii. Strata Subdivision
One block divided into apartments or units is a strata subdivision.

iii. Bare Land Strata Subdivison
One block of land subdivided vertically where the blocs will be divided has not yet been built is the bare land strata subdivision.

iv. Battle–Axe Subdivision
Dividing a land block for being axe-shaped for the new home to be built at the property's back is a battle-axe subdivision.

v. Development Subdivision
One large land plot sliced for allowing for multiple titles is a development subdivision.

Hence, subdividing is basically when a block of land is sliced into two or more separate blocks having their title. Based on the situation, these five subdivision types will have to be considered.

When you are considering a residential subdivision, and the steps are completed with the land being split into two, then you would wonder what is to be done next. The options include keeping the lot vacant, constructing property on it or selling the vacant land.

Why Do the Property Investors Have to Subdivide?
Subdividing seems good when you have a backyard and have planned to put it to productive use. It might be developed into a massive block or multiple smaller blocks. There might be any reasoning – subdividing is guided by a few general ideas.

The chief reason to subdivide property is to regenerate profit. After subdividing, when a land plot is sold, then the profit margin rises by 10% more.  

On the other hand, when the new block is to be retained, then equity can be increased based on how much the plot is worth on its own as against how much worth as one block. Even it takes into account whether a new house is to be built on the house on the new block or whether it should be kept vacant.

If you are deciding to keep it and then construct it, then rent out the newly constructed house as an investment property. It is sure to be a passive income increase when geared positively, or the taxable income decreases when geared negatively.
 
In the end, the property investors have their reasons for subdividing the property. The reasoning is depended on what is decided to be done with one block being subdivided along with the financial goals.
